Acute diarrhea, a common gastrointestinal disturbance, is characterized by the rapid evacuation of fluid stools, leading to an excessive weight in fluid. This condition typically arises from disorders affecting intestinal water and electrolyte transport. It can be triggered by an increased osmotic load within the intestine, excessive secretion of electrolytes and water, mucosal exudation of protein and fluid, or altered intestinal motility. The gut microbiome is formed by a vast and diverse community of bacteria that colonizes our large intestine. These bacteria start residing in the gut from birth and continue diversifying throughout life, influenced by factors such as diet, lifestyle, and stress. The gut bacterial community also includes bacteria from food and those that enter the colon through the anus.
The normal gut flora of the colon plays a critical role in generating essential vitamins such as vitamins K, B5, and B7.

Long-Term Antibiotics for Disturbed Bladder Microbiome Disorders.

Yasir Bukhari1,2,3, Ryan Chow4, Alexander Jie Xiang5

  • 1Department of Obstetrics and Gynecology, King Abdulaziz University, Jeddah, Saudi Arabia. y.bukhari34@gmail.com.

International Urogynecology Journal
|May 6, 2025
PubMed
Summary

Long-term antibiotics show promise for treating infectious bladder microbiome disorders like recurrent UTIs and chronic cystitis. Cephalexin, fluoroquinolones, and fosfomycin are effective, with cephalexin being a preferred option due to its safety profile.

Area of Science:

  • Urology
  • Microbiology
  • Pharmacology

Background:

  • The bladder microbiome plays a crucial role in maintaining bladder health.
  • Disruptions in the bladder microbiome are linked to conditions like recurrent UTIs, interstitial cystitis, and chronic cystitis.

Purpose of the Study:

  • To review the current literature on bladder microbiome composition and associated disorders.
  • To evaluate the efficacy of long-term antibiotic treatment for disturbed bladder microbiome (DBM) disorders.

Main Methods:

  • A focused literature review was conducted.
  • Studies evaluating long-term antibiotic treatment (over 28 days) for DBM disorders were collected and analyzed.

Main Results:

  • Long-term antibiotics demonstrated encouraging outcomes for infectious DBM disorders, including recurrent UTIs and chronic recalcitrant cystitis.
  • No significant benefit was observed for interstitial cystitis patients.
  • Cephalexin, fluoroquinolones, and fosfomycin were found to be well-tolerated and effective, with cephalexin showing a favorable side-effect profile.

Conclusions:

  • Long-term antibiotic therapy is a viable option for managing infectious DBM disorders.
  • Cephalexin is a recommended treatment choice due to its efficacy and safety.
  • Further research is needed to explore future therapeutic avenues for DBM disorders.
